    HI! I had posted a message 2 weeks ago regarding c-section vs vaginal delivery. Baby A was head down and Baby B was transverse.

    Well, on Wed - June 27 - I was induced at 38 wks pregnant. Baby A was head down and B was breech. Baby A was delivered at 2:22PM vaginally with just 2 pushes. Robert weighed in at 6lb6oz and was 19 inches long. Baby B was attempted to deliver via vaginal delivery. However, she flipped shoulder and hand first. After manipulation from the doctors, they were unable to turn her in either direction and she was delivered C-section at 2:48 PM weighing 6lb3oz. Megan and Robert were healthy and required no NICU time and were with us the entire stay in the hospital.

    I had posted the message regarding whether or not to attempt the vaginal delivery or just go C-section. My advice to anyone out there who can attempt a vaginal delivery - DO IT!!! I have now experienced 3 vaginal deliveries and 1 C-section. THe C-section is a much more difficult recovery than a vaginal birth. I would make the same decision again.

    THe most important thing is that we have two healthy babies and the entire family is doing great!!!! Thanks for all the previous replies to my post. It did help in the decision making process.
